| TheChilliGod08-24-05, 05:07 AM | Gah, that title was a bit confusing. Anyway, I just finished making a nice githzerai druid of ECL 6, for a campaign by one of my campaign's players and a friend of mine who's pretty open to most things, completely closed-minded to others. Anyway, I'm featuring this druid around the wolf stereotype, with a wolf companion and a PC werewolf follower. The wolf companion, thanks to a little feat called Natural Bond, (+3 to your effective druid level for companion's bonuses, from Complete Adventurer) the wolf has 6 hit dice. Now the questions. 1) Because the wolf now has 6 hit dice, does it now have a large size as per the HD advancement? 2) If so, would I then be able to use the wolf as a mount? It does get feats and skills, as the Animal Companion sidebar says. It does not get anything else from normal Advancement, because it isn't being Advanced, it is being granted bonus HD for being your animal companion. If you were to release it from that bond, it would return to being a completely normal wolf, statistically. So, no size, and no attribute bonuses, or anything else. The attribute bonuses from being an animal companion are better, anyway, you just don't have any choice as to how much goes to which stat. |
